The 2024 Amazon Bestsellers List was significantly impacted by a book that didn't release until late in the year: Onyx Storm, the latest installment in Rebecca Yarros's Empyrean series. While this might seem unusual, the series' success is largely attributable to its viral popularity on BookTok, mirroring the trajectory of Colleen Hoover's It Ends With Us.

Despite its late release, Onyx Storm secured the number two spot on Amazon's 2024 bestseller list. The Women by Kristin Hannah claimed the top position, having also topped the New York Times bestseller list earlier in the year. Here's a glimpse at the top ten:

  1. The Women - Kristin Hannah
  2. Onyx Storm - Rebecca Yarros
  3. Atomic Habits - James Clear
  4. Hillbilly Elegy - J.D. Vance
  5. The Housemaid - Freida McFadden
  6. Mom, I Want to Hear Your Story - Jeffrey Mason
  7. Dad, I Want to Hear Your Story - Jeffrey Mason
  8. The Anxious Generation - Jonathan Haidt
  9. It Ends With Us - Colleen Hoover
  10. Good Energy - Casey Means M.D.
